A wire of 62.0 cm length and 13 g mass is suspended by a pair of flexible leads in a magnetic field of 0.440 T (Fig. 29-35). What are the magnitude and direction of the current required to remove the tension in the supporting leads??

Magnitude:

_________ A

Solution

the magnitude of the current is,

   i = mg/LB                   [Since, F = BiL, so mg = BiL]

     = 13*10^-3*9.8* / 0.62*0.44

     = 0.467 A

Direction: to the right
